Lack of capitalization: Those who write about a garage band generally forget that capitalization of proper nouns is an important skill when writing the English language.Bad grammar can be apparent in the body of the article, as well. If a new article has "(band)"-especially the incorrect capitalization style "(Band)"-in the title, there's a good chance this is a garage band article. ![]() Many garage bands tend to name their articles with a precise title, such as My Rock Group (band) instead of just My Rock Group, even when there is no reason to disambiguate the article title. Garage band articles generally share several characteristics: Although Wikipedia articles about unknown bands are created by editors all over the world, a garage band article is often written by the band itself.
